Shiite Muslims mark holy day of Ashoura after months of war in Iran and Lebanon
Shiite Muslims worldwide observed Ashoura, a holy day commemorating the martyrdom of Imam Hussein, amid ongoing wars in Iran and Lebanon. The day follows months of conflict, including an Israeli airstrike that killed Iran's supreme le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ei and Hezbollah-led battles in Lebanon, with Ashoura coinciding with Khamenei's funeral and efforts by displaced Lebanese to return home.
